Steel Strong: The Power of Stainless Steel

You know what? Stainless steel isn't just for those shiny kitchen appliances. In the world of pest control, it's celebrated for its corrosion resistance and ability to withstand chemical attacks. This means no matter what pesticide or herbicide you’re carrying, your tank won’t degrade. Plus, its durability means it lasts longer, saving you money. Who doesn’t love the idea of fewer replacements and repairs?

Light and Tough: Polyethylene Plastic

Now, here’s a real MVP: polyethylene plastic. This material is lightweight—a huge plus when you're lugging it around—and incredibly resilient to impacts and, yep, corrosion. What’s even better? Its molded design can eliminate seams that might otherwise be weak points prone to leaking. Let’s face it: NO ONE wants a leaky sprayer tank!

But wait, it gets better. Polyethylene can handle an extensive range of chemicals, making it a versatile pick for different types of treatments.

The Allure of Fiberglass

Don’t sleep on fiberglass! This material strikes a great balance between strength and weight. It’s not just durable; it also resists the elements and chemical corrosion like a champ. If your job leads you outdoors frequently, you’ll appreciate how fiberglass tanks can keep up with the unpredictable weather—rain, sun, or whatever Mother Nature decides to throw at you.

What About Other Materials?

Now, you might be wondering about those other materials—like aluminum and wood. Although they have their own uses, they come with some serious drawbacks for sprayer tank construction. For example, aluminum can corrode with specific chemicals, potentially compromising your tank’s integrity. And wood? Well, it’s not exactly the best choice for chemical containment, as it tends to absorb liquids, leading to degradation over time. Nobody wants a tank that’s falling apart!

Composite materials? They can be hit or miss in terms of their durability and resistance to chemicals, so it’s hard to recommend them as a reliable option.
